The long-running charity fund-raising concerts by THE SINGING FARMERS are back again for 2010! Tickets are NOW ON SALE for the 4 performances which will take place on the following dates & at the following venues:  SUNDAY 14 MARCH – APPLEBY PUBLIC HALL, Appleby in Westmorland starts 2.30pm; SUNDAY 21 MARCH – KIRKBYMOORSIDE MEMORIAL HALL, Kirkbymoorside starts 2.30pm; FRIDAY 26 MARCH – ALLERTONSHIRE SCHOOL, Northallerton starts 7.30pm; SUNDAY 28 MARCH – DARLEY MEMORIAL HALL, Nidderdale starts 2.30pm    THE SINGING FARMERS are 5 individual singers all related to the farming and rural world, plus a keyboard player. They are: CHRIS BERRY – renowned rural journalist; KEN JACKSON, CHARLES MARWOOD and TONY RICHARDS – all farmers; PHILLIP HOLDEN – farm supply shop owner; and LLOYD LOCKWOOD – rural music teacher. The concerts have been taking place since 2004 and 4 concerts take place each year. Funds are raised for charity and the RABI (Royal Agricultural Benevolent Institution) has been the main beneficiary throughout. THE SINGING FARMERS have raised over £100,000 during the past 6 years. The songs range from Country to Folk, Pop to Shows and the events are very popular particularly in the age range 40s to 80s.

66,700 reasons why Joe Longthorne’s book is closer to being completed

December 14, 2009

Amazing entertainer and the best balladeer in Britain, Joe Longthorne, is edging ever closer to having his first ever autobiography completed.

Joe Longthorne in concert @ Royal Leamington Spa 2009

Chris Berry, a good friend of Joe’s and a singer in his own right, is the author who is ghost-writing the book on Joe’s behalf and last week saw the book reach 66,700 words.  ‘I’ve just reached 2001 in Joe’s timeline,’ says Chris. ‘Which means there is so much still left to tell. Joe’s life has been one long, huge emotional rollercoaster ride and he is presently on another upturn in his career. His story tells of the rag-and-bone origins to the platinum selling albums – his subsequent demise, his illnesses and the long and winding road back to the top. Throughout it all his fans have remained stoically loyal and remain so to this day. His bisexuality, his drug taking, his bankruptcy, his nervous breakdown, his court appearances – nothing has ever altered his fans opinion of him. They love ‘Our Joe’.’   The book, provisionaly titled ‘JOE LONGTHORNE The Official Autobiography’ is due to be published in late March. Provisional dates for the book release : A limited number of advance copies will be available around 19 March 2010, with all pre-ordered copies available 26 March – 1 April  2010.  The book is being published by Great Northern Books.
